What exactly is a “control system” and what is it trying to control?
The suggestion is, I assume, that other entities – ETs, angels, demons, just “others” – are establishing a condition that eventually controls, psychologically (and physically?), human beings. And to some end, not clarified by the great Vallee – whom I like actually.

"In evaluating Vallee's control system hypothesis, the obvious questions are: who or what is in charge and managing it? If something non-human, then what? Where is the real evidence for this idea, other than that some of Vallee's carefully selected cases can be made (with difficulty) to force-fit the theory? Most people care little about UFOs and have no interest in the subject, so how does this theory stand up? If some kind of inter-dimensional control system it seems pointless, futile, a failure. The reader should make up his own mind, and follow through the arguments expanded in Vallee's subsequent works `Messengers of Deception' (1979) and the `Dimensions' trilogy (1988-91)."
